Skip to content
View MahmoudZarad's full-sized avatar

Highlights

  • Pro

Block or report MahmoudZarad

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
MahmoudZarad/README.md

πŸš€ About Me

  • Backend-focused engineer passionate about building scalable and maintainable systems.
  • Strong foundation in Data Structures, Algorithms, OOP, and System Design.
  • Experienced in building real-world systems like:
    • πŸ›’ E-Commerce API (Web Api)
    • πŸš— DVLD Management System (Full Desktop Application)
    • 🏦 Full Banking System (C++)

🧠 Core Backend Stack

C# .NET ASP.NET Core Entity Framework ADO.NET LINQ JWT Swagger Postman


πŸ— Architecture & Principles

OOP System Design Clean Architecture CQRS Domain Driven Design SOLID Design Patterns Repository Pattern Unit of Work Separation of Concerns Dependency Injection Middleware & Pipeline Clean Code

πŸ—„ Databases

SQL Server T-SQL SSMS Databases


πŸ’» Programming Foundations

C++ Python JavaScript Algorithms Data Structures Problem Solving


🌐 Web Fundamentals

HTML5 CSS RESTful APIs


πŸ–₯ Desktop Development

Windows Forms .NET Framework


βš™ Tools

Git GitHub Version Control Linux


πŸŽ“ Education

Faculty of Computers & Information
Mansoura University

🧠 Computer Science Foundations

  • Data Structures & Algorithms
  • Operating Systems
  • Computer Organization & Architecture
  • Database Systems
  • Digital Logic & Computer Design
  • Probability & Statistics
  • Linear Algebra
  • Discrete Mathematics
  • Networking & Data Communications
  • Calculus

🧠 Engineering Philosophy

Backend development is not about making it work.
It's about designing systems that survive scale.

Pinned Loading

  1. DVLD-Management-System DVLD-Management-System Public

    DVLD Management System is a Windows Desktop Application designed to manage users, roles, persons, drivers, tests, bookings, and the full driving license lifecycle including issuance, renewal, withd…

    C# 1

  2. Digital_Mesaharaty Digital_Mesaharaty Public

    A .NET 10 digital 'Mesaharaty' (Ramadan Herald) that leverages Gemini AI and Hangfire to broadcast unique, daily spiritual and social messages to Telegram at 8:00 AM. Featuring automated scheduling…

    C#

  3. E-Commerce E-Commerce Public

    Production-ready e-commerce Web API built with ASP.NET Core using Clean Architecture principles, Implements JWT authentication, role-based authorization, refresh tokens, secure email verification, …

    C# 1

  4. Full_Banking_System_CPP Full_Banking_System_CPP Public

    A complete Banking Management System built in C++ with OOP and file handling concepts.

    C++

  5. My_Portfolio_Website_Project My_Portfolio_Website_Project Public

    A clean and fully responsive website built with HTML and CSS, showcasing layout design, responsive structure for all screen sizes, and clean styling. A step in strengthening my web development skills.

    HTML

  6. MyBackendportfolio MyBackendportfolio Public

    Personal Portfolio: A high-performance, responsive showcase of my expertise in Backend Engineering (.NET)

    HTML